I feel like Chinese A: Let’s go out to eat.
B: That sounds like fun. A: Where do you want to go? B: Let me think a minute. A: I feel like Chinese. B: That sounds delicious. A: I know a good Chinese restaurant. B: How far away is it? A: It’s only 10 minutes from here. B: Do we need reservations? A: Oh, no. We can walk right in. B: Let’s go now. I’m hungry! |
